Plain and useful directions for those who are afflicted with cancers. By which they may save themselves a great deal of pain and danger; Pass every Hour of their Lives more comfortably; And see all that is to be performed toward a cure. With an account of the Vienna hemlock; With which Dr. Stork did so great good in Cancers. And A History of some absolute Cures performed by the English Herb Cleavers; communicated to the Author by a Lady of Quality; and authenticated by the Testimony of a Clergyman, who saw them. By Dr. Hill, member of the Imperial Academy, &c.
- Hill, John, 1714?-1775.
